Amsterdam’s Affordable Commercial Space initiative provides 19K SF of retail space for minority-owned businesses at 30% of market rate, fostering economic inclusion. Partnering with Atlanta BeltLine, Inc., supports long-term stability and equitable growth in a high-visibility location.
Affordable Commercial Space
-
19,000 GSF of ground-floor retail and restaurant space reserved exclusively for small, local, minority-owned businesses
Leased at 30% of market rate, enabling long-term stability for underrepresented entrepreneurs
-
Tenant screening and support managed through the BeltLine Marketplace program
Ensures authenticity, transparency, and alignment with the BeltLine’s mission to close the racial wealth gap

Situated on the Atlanta BeltLine Eastside Trail, near Piedmont Park & Atlanta Botanical Garden
Offers entrepreneurs unparalleled exposure in one of the city's most visited areas
